Post by biggydx on Sept 12, 2019 18:46:23 GMT
I'm thinking 2023 (H1) at the latest, though a 2022 (H2) release is also viable. Since the game is in pre-production, they're likely going to want to have at least two years of full development time before shipping the game. I don't see that squaring with a 2021 release date (even in the holiday).
EDIT: I think what makes the date much harder to ascertain is how - on one hand - BioWare (Casey specifically) is saying that DA4 is still in preproduction, but then there's Schreiers reporting that indicates they already had elements in place with Joplin, but parts of it were being scrapped. I wonder if the main reasoning behind why its in preproduction now is because they're having to transfer over whatever elements they originally crafted for Joplin over to Anthems framework; as it was originally using DA:I's framework. Of course, there's also the introduction of live elements; whatever that means at this point.
